supanet launches auction channel in association with eBay.co.uk – Company Business and Marketing – Brief Article

INTERNET BUSINESS NEWS-(C)1995-2001 M2 COMMUNICATIONS LTD

The UK-based Internet service provider supanet has teamed up with the online marketplace eBay to launch an auction channel.

Trials of the new channel, which is designed to enable supanet’s users to buy and sell various products, have already begun. Under the agreement supanet will benefit financially when its customers register with eBay.co.uk.
